When the day calls for special dinnerware, trust the elegant 1616 / Arita Palace Plate to add a regal touch to your dinner table. Exclusively designed by Teruhiro Yanagihara for the Palace Hotel Tokyo, this exquisite plate is inspired by the auspicious Chrysanthemum flower — the emblem of Japan's imperial family. It is delicately hand-crafted in the ancient town of Arita using a dense clay of crushed stone, which gives it its remarkable durability. A timeless matte light gray tone tastefully complements any appetizers, small meals, or dessert.
